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

The Maintenance Reliability Supervisor will be responsible for identifying opportunities to improve our asset reliability and implement appropriate improvements to the reliability centered maintenance process. The position will require leading a crew of reliability technicians and driving equipment reliability.

Job Responsibilities:

The position has primary responsibility to drive the continuous improvement of our asset reliability and manufacturing KPIs at the Winchester, VA site, this includes, but isn’t limited to:

  • Daily work with reliability group: Identifying asset reliability issues, managing daily preventative/predictive programs, documenting/trending asset quality and continuous improvement.

  • Leading and training a team of reliability technicians on preventative maintenance program best practices, developing technician technical knowledge, improving reliability tasks and equipment uptimes.

  • Provide subject matter expertise regarding preventative maintenance standards, predictive maintenance technologies, vibration analyzation, ultrasound analyzation, oil sampling and thermography.

  • Working with engineering and maintenance groups: Leading and assisting in projects that drive improvement in new equipment purchase reliability standards, and efficiency of future maintainability. Drive cost savings measures through value added reliability maintenance practices, with the goal of attaining world class reliability metrics.

  • Report to Maintenance Manager in measuring key reliability performance metrics and executing improvement projects to provide a clear path to world class reliability goals, preparing reports and implementing process mapping.

  • Makes implementation and results a top priority and regularly updates the plant’s implementation plan.

  • Communicates the status of improvement efforts to both the plant management and other engineering resources throughout the division. Provides documentation of results and benefits achieved.

  • Shares “maintenance best practice” methods and ideas across plants/divisions.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• 5+ years of Industrial maintenance experience.

  • Background in industrial maintenance reliability and continuous improvement.

  • Working understanding of hydraulic, mechanical, and electrical systems.

  • Working understanding of injection molding machines and processing.

  • Working knowledge of six sigma tools and methodology, strong quantitative, analytical and process redesign skills, along with the excellent project management skills are required.

  • Excellent communication skills to lead and support empowered employees in a team environment.

  • Good presentation skills to effectively share the success and ideas.

  • Able to work with minimum supervision.

  • High energy, self-motivated, enthusiastic, well organized.

  • Able to work in a team environment.

Preferable Characteristics:

  • Understanding of industrial manufacturing processes.

  • Certified Maintenance Reliability Professional Certification.

  • Have a well-developed concept of Reliability Centered Maintenance or Total Predictive Maintenance philosophies.

  • Demonstrated ability to not only use Six Sigma and Lean Principles such as DMAIC, SPC, Cpk, GR&R, Control Plans, DOE, Value Stream Mapping, 5S, Visual Factory, TPM, Kaizen, JIT, Demand Flow, Single Piece Flow, SMED as well as other Continuous Improvement Process tools.
